想写出更简洁、安全的 Swift 代码?试试这些技巧: 函数编程: 用柯里化将多参数函数拆成单参数函数链。掌握 map、filter、reduce 等高阶函数来处理集合。 枚举: 利用关联值扩展枚举功能。使用 CaseIterable 协议自动获取枚举所有 case。 结构体与枚举: 用 mut
Swift 18 次浏览
总结了 Swift 3.0 版本中一些实用技巧,帮助开发者更高效地编写代码。内容涵盖语法糖、标准库使用、常见问题解决方案等方面。通过学习这些技巧,读者可以提升代码可读性、可维护性和性能。 示例: 利用可选链式调用简化代码 使用 map 和 filter 进行函数式编程 理解值类型和引用类型的区别
IOS 19 次浏览
### 100swift技巧详解####一、Selector **知识点:** - **Selector**是Objective-C中用于表示消息传递的一种方式,在Swift中也可以通过`#selector`来使用。 - Selector可以用来作为方法的引用,这对于实现回调、事件响应等功能非常有用
IOS 18 次浏览
掌握 Swift 编程语言的实用技巧对于开发者来说至关重要。高效的代码实现、最佳实践以及常见问题的解决方案能够显著提升开发效率和代码质量。
IOS 28 次浏览
经过实际测试,发现Swift语言的高级功能非常实用。推荐大家深入学习,不容错过!
IOS 22 次浏览
CandySearch 项目展示了如何在 Swift 中实现 TableView 筛选功能。该项目兼容 Xcode 6.2 和 iOS 7.0 以上版本。通过学习 CandySearch,您可以深入了解 TableView 筛选的实现方法和技巧。
Swift 21 次浏览
这份文档集合了 100 个 Swift 必备技巧,提升 Swift 开发者的技术水平,涵盖了函数式编程、语法特性、性能优化和代码风格等各个方面。
IOS 25 次浏览
由王巍撰写的《Swift必备100个实用技巧》帮助开发者快速掌握Swift,建议支持作者购买正版书。
IOS 23 次浏览
Swift 界面布局与动画技巧 案例:登录界面 本案例基于 Xcode 6.3 构建,探讨如何实现登录界面布局和动画效果。 混合布局 结合 Auto Layout 和坐标定位,灵活构建界面元素的位置和尺寸关系。 动画效果 利用 UIView 动画 API,为界面元素添加生动的过渡效果,提升用户体验。
IOS 21 次浏览
Swift开发指南:实用技巧分享。这篇指南不仅详细介绍了Swift语言的开发内容,还分享了一些实用的开发技巧和经验。无论是初学者还是有经验的开发者,都可以从中受益。
IOS 31 次浏览